Soljor had learned to let his girls go about. It seemed to be a common mental state for them to disappear for a few weeks at a time after birth. He was hopeful that Arachne and Neilina would return to the herd in time. He just wouldn’t pressure them. He had started to become worried though, as after Sophia had passed the little girl she’d had seemed to vanish as well. Soljor had come across her dead body some time back; cold and several days old. It had disturbed him, especially since their child must have come at some point during her isolation.

Soljor always wondered if he’d done enough for the brindle mare. And then Arachne had also disappeared. He figured she was still around, as he caught her scent periodically, but she didn’t show herself. It was a little depressing. But, while grazing about the outskirts of the herd when he heard a faint call.

A familiar one.

Soljor’s head jerked upwards. Arachne.

It didn’t take him long to find the painted mare. She stood a bit off from two fillies. Soljor’s heart nearly stopped. One of course was Neilina. She was shaping up to be a pretty little filly. In some ways, she was reminding him of his own damn, though different in color. The other… The other resembled Peyton in color, though a bit lighter. And shared the painted features of himself.

Where had she come from? Could it be…

Soljor could ask soon enough. He closed the distance between himself and Arachne, offering a low call to her so he didn’t startle her. He didn’t want to disturb the girls’ fun just yet.

“Arachne,” Soljor greeted, reaching out his muzzle towards hers. “I’m glad to see you’re still here.” His words were truthful. At the least, he would rather have had a goodbye had she chosen to disappear forever.
